Transaction 70a66849edf582dddae595ad1135d17aba042fb3bd76bdea7136ecbadd1e8523
1 Input
2 Outputs
- 70a66849edf582dddae595ad1135d17aba042fb3bd76bdea7136ecbadd1e8523:0
- 70a66849edf582dddae595ad1135d17aba042fb3bd76bdea7136ecbadd1e8523:1
value 1000339
address 14waXCHkuwZ11Hb1QdnYdimgzBFX3edfE3
value 18068610
address 1H4jomiHnXqTCYGvTjWH6kz3CPgNEp2tGY